MIGRANT hotels and accommodation will cost £15billion over a decade, a spending watchdog has revealed.

- By Michael Knowles Home Affairs Editor

Housing costs for triple to £15bn says

Taxpayers will shell out £4.19million a day on housing asylum seekers over the 10-year contracts awarded to Serco, Clearsprings Ready Homes and Mears Group in 2019.

This is triple what the Home Office predicted and the average yearly cost is now expected to be higher than the amount ministers hope to save from cutting the winter fuel payment.

Fears are intensifying that the bill will rise further, with a record number of migrants crossing the Channel this year.

Shadow Home Secretary Chris Philp said: “Labour has lost control of our borders. The consequence of this is increasing numbers in hotels at vast cost to the UK taxpayer.

“The only way to end this madness is to remove every illegal immigrant as soon as they arrive, either back to their country of origin or a third country like Rwanda.”

He added that Labour cancelling the removal scheme was “shameful”, adding the Prime Minister is “letting Britain down”.

Tory MP Neil O’Brien said: “Normally someone would resign over a £10billion overspend, but no one will.

“Record numbers are now crossing the Channel under Starmer and this won’t get fixed until we leave the thicket of human rights law which lawyers like Starmer have created.”
